Aracely Arambula Jacques grew up in Chihuahua City Mexico with her father Manuel Arambula, and mother Socorro Jaques. La Chule was her name for family and friends. Aracely first began participating in beauty pageants in the year 13 when she turned thirteen. The most notable thing about her appearances was events that made her well-known in the place she was raised in. Aracely Arambula made her movie debut in 1994 playing an unidentified role in the film Prisionera de Amor directed by Pedro Damian for Televisa. She was Leticia Cisneros a year later in Canaveral de Pasiones. Latewr in 1996 Aracely contested the El Rostro de El Heraldo de Mexico (The face of El Heraldo de Mexico) and won. Being named the face of the highly regarded award brought her good publicity, and she began taking on more telenovela characters. Aracely played minor film roles into the late 1990s. These included Mujer Casos de la Vida Real (1996), El Alma Notiene Color 1997 and Alma Rebelde 1999. Aracely was first cast in the year 2000, as Maria del Carmen, opposite Fernando Colunga & Helena Rojo in Abrazam muy Fuerte. Her role in the telenovela earned her the Best Actress Award at the El Heraldo de Mexico Awards in 2001. Following that she portrayed Perla in Las Vias del Amor (a Mexican Telenovela) directed by Emilio Larrosa and Televisa. The song she sang served as the show's theme. show.
